New York
In a city that is crowded like New York, scooters are an easy and efficient way to get around. It is crucial to understand the laws that govern scooters prior to you take the wheel. This will help you avoid injury and fines.
In general, you do not need a special license to operate an electric scooter in New York. However there are a few exceptions. First, you must be 16 or older to be able to drive on a scooter. Additionally, you must wear a helmet at all times. Register your scooter, and make sure you have insurance. You can also only use your scooter on bike lanes.
If you're looking to buy a scooter, it is crucial to determine the engine's size. The New York State Department of Motor Vehicles classifies mopeds and Scooters based on the size of their engines. If your scooter is a moped and has a piston capacity of 50cc or less it is not required to have to obtain a driver's license. If your scooter has an engine displacement of 50 cc or more, it's classified a motorcycle, and requires the Class M license or Class MJ.
In addition to these rules that you must adhere to all regular traffic laws when riding a scooter around New York. In addition, you should wear a helmet and eye protection at all times. Georgia
The state of Georgia has specific laws and regulations for scooters. These rules apply both to mopeds as well as electric scooters. The most important rule is to wear a helmet. You must also be at least 15 years old to operate a motorized scooter. You also need an active driver's license or learner's permit to be able to drive on the road. You also must obtain a moped permit and pass an annual vehicle check. You should also have liability insurance that covers property damage and bodily injuries suffered by others when you cause a crash.
The law defines a scooter as a motor-driven cycle that has two or three wheels and a motor that is 50 cm or less in size. To operate a scooter within the state, you must wear a helmet and a learner's license or driver's license. The motor can't produce more than 2 brake horsepower and the scooter is able to travel at 30 mph on an even surface.
You must also obey all other traffic laws in the state. You must obey the speed limit and yield to pedestrians with the right-of-way. If you break any of these laws, you could be accused of committing a serious crime.

New Mexico
In New Mexico, any two-wheeled motor-driven bicycle that exceeds 50 cc must be insured and registered like in every state. These vehicles are referred to as scooters and mopeds in many states, however their names could be different. If your moped, scooter or motorcycle comes with a helper motor, it must not be larger than 50cc and not exceed two brake horsepower. The vehicle must include a driver's seat as well as a taillight and headlight.
The state you live will determine whether you need a scooter license. It also depends on the speed at which your moped is able to travel on public roads. Certain states require a specific license or an endorsement on your regular driver's license to drive mopeds. While others require you to have a standard driver's license. You can go through the rules for your specific state and county to learn more.
The NM Department of Transportation (DOT) considers any vehicle with pedals on the feet for human-assisted propulsion and an attached motor not bigger than 50cc and generating no more than 2 brake horsepower to be moped. Mopeds must be licensed and registered in order to be able to drive on roads that are public, and must be in compliance with all other requirements for motorcycles, such as emissions testing and liability insurance.
If you plan to ride your scooter or moped on public roadways you'll need a helmet that is DOT-approved and eye protection. You'll also have to bring a Low-Powered Scooter registration application as well as proof of identity and proof of insurance for your motorcycle. You can get this form online or at your local MVD office.
New Mexico has seen a rise in popularity of e-scooters. A lot of people hire these vehicles through private companies. Some even use them to travel to work. However, not all people realize that they need to have a motorcycle driving license in order to legally operate these vehicles on public roads. Some e-scooters can reach speeds of up 30 miles per hour, which means they are regarded as motorized vehicles. This means that you'll require a class M motorcycle license.
